PVH (NYSE:PVH) Earns Buy Rating from Needham & Company LLC

PVH (NYSE:PVHGet Free Report)‘s stock had its “buy” rating reiterated by stock analysts at Needham & Company LLC in a research note issued on Thursday, Marketbeat reports. They currently have a $100.00 target price on the textile maker’s stock. Needham & Company LLC’s target price suggests a potential upside of 27.50% from the stock’s previous close.

Other equities analysts have also issued reports about the stock. UBS Group reaffirmed a “buy” rating and set a $148.00 target price on shares of PVH in a report on Tuesday, November 25th. Telsey Advisory Group restated an “outperform” rating and set a $95.00 price target on shares of PVH in a research report on Thursday. Wall Street Zen upgraded shares of PVH from a “hold” rating to a “buy” rating in a research report on Sunday, October 12th. BTIG Research initiated coverage on shares of PVH in a research note on Tuesday, October 14th. They set a “buy” rating and a $100.00 target price on the stock. Finally, Wells Fargo & Company lifted their price target on PVH from $80.00 to $88.00 and gave the company an “equal weight” rating in a research note on Thursday, August 28th. Nine equ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and eight have assigned a Hold r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$92.00.

PVH Stock Performance

NYSE PVH opened at $78.43 on Thursday. The firm has a market capitalization of $3.77 billion, a P/E ratio of 11.76, a PEG ratio of 2.40 and a beta of 1.74.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$80.79 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$77.97.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.46, a quick ratio of 0.63 and a current ratio of 1.47. PVH has a fifty-two week low of $59.28 and a fifty-two week high of $111.96.

PVH (NYSE:PVHG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, December 3rd. The textile maker reported $2.83 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.56 by $0.27. The firm had revenue of $2.29 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.28 billion. PVH had a return on equity of 11.44% and a net margin of 3.87%.PVH’s revenue for the quarter was up 1.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company earned $3.03 earnings per share. PVH has set its Q4 2025 guidance at 3.200-3.350 EPS and its FY 2025 guidance at 10.850-11.000 EPS. On average, equities analysts forecast that PVH will post 11.67 earnings per share for the current year.

About PVH

PVH Corp. operates as an apparel company in the United States and internationally. The company operates through Tommy Hilfiger North America, Tommy Hilfiger International, Calvin Klein North America, Calvin Klein International, and Heritage Brands Wholesale segments. It designs and markets men's, women's, and children's branded apparel, footwear and accessories, underwear, sleepwear, outerwear, home furnishings, luggage, dresses, suits and swimwear, activewear, sportswear, socks and accessories, outerwear, golf products, footwear, watches and jewelry, eyeglasses and non-ophthalmic sunglasses, jeans wear, performance apparel, intimate apparel, dress shirts, handbags, fragrance, small leather goods, and other related products; and men's and boy's tailored clothing products, duvets, pillows, mattress pads and toppers, and feather beds.
